Uncooked substance Optimization: Conserving Resources, Reducing stress

The journey of any created item starts with Uncooked supplies, as well as environmental Price associated with their extraction and processing is substantial. Mining ores, refining metals, and transporting these essential resources eat wide amounts of Electrical power and h2o, frequently resulting in habitat disruption and significant greenhouse fuel emissions. A core basic principle of sustainable style and design, consequently, is to attain far more with less.

modern day expansion tank style and design embraces this theory via arduous raw product optimization. By using Superior engineering techniques, makers can generate tanks that satisfy or simply exceed the functionality benchmarks of more mature, heavier types, but with substantially less content input. this is not about compromising high quality; It truly is about clever style and design. Finite ingredient Investigation (FEA) together with other simulation equipment permit engineers to pinpoint stress points and reinforce important spots although eradicating needless mass in other places.

The end result is often a direct reduction within the demand from customers for virgin resources like metal. much less metal expected per tank indicates fewer iron ore must be mined, processed, and transported, leading to a cascading reduction within the involved environmental footprint – lower energy consumption, much less emissions, and decreased tension on all-natural landscapes.

Also, this optimization technique usually goes hand-in-hand with the choice of much more sustainable supplies. top brands are progressively using high-energy, small-carbon metal or stainless-steel alternatives. These products don't just present outstanding longevity and corrosion resistance, guaranteeing an extended support existence, but They're also very recyclable. picking supplies with significant recycled written content and creating for conclusion-of-existence disassembly supports a more circular financial state, reducing waste and further lessening the reliance on Most important resource extraction. light-weight design and style: Driving Transportation Efficiency and decreasing Emissions

The Bodily fat of an item has profound implications for its logistical footprint. Heavier things call for a lot more Strength to transport, translating directly into bigger gas use and enhanced carbon emissions. the advantages of light-weight enlargement tanks come to be particularly obvious when inspecting the transportation period.

evaluate the journey with the production facility to distribution facilities And eventually to installation sites. A lighter growth tank signifies that a lot more units can be loaded on to an individual truck or packed into a shipping container. This enhanced density per cargo significantly improves transportation efficiency. less truck journeys are wanted to provide precisely the same range of tanks, leading to a immediate reduction in gasoline use along with the linked emissions of CO2, NOx, and particulate subject.

This gain is amplified for extensive-length transportation, especially in the context of Global trade and exports. Manufacturing system Vitality financial savings: The Power of Precision

The environmental effects of an item just isn't entirely based on its resources and transportation; the manufacturing system alone is a major element. light-weight style and design concepts normally necessitate a lot more precise and economical producing techniques, which inherently bring about Electrical power personal savings and waste reduction.

smart style and design focused on minimizing content utilization typically leads to more simple geometries or optimized types that have to have less advanced fabrication processes. As an example, patterns could lower the amount of unique parts that must be welded collectively. Welding is surely an Electricity-intensive approach; lowering the variety or duration of welds straight cuts down on electrical energy usage for the duration of producing.

Also, precision engineering allows increased materials utilization charges. Innovative cutting and forming methods is usually used To optimize the quantity of components received from only one sheet of metallic, reducing offcuts and scrap content. considerably less scrap indicates significantly less waste to manage, reprocess, or eliminate, saving Electricity and resources. This dedication to reducing waste aligns with lean producing ideas, improving each environmental effectiveness and manufacturing performance.

Efficient production processes optimized for light-weight patterns might also lead to a reduction in affiliated industrial byproducts. For example, lowered welding may possibly necessarily mean decreased fume generation, although optimized coating procedures could reduce unstable natural compound (VOC) emissions or lessen h2o usage and wastewater therapy needs. Extending the Use Cycle: toughness Meets decreased squander

a standard misunderstanding is light-weight design equates to diminished strength or durability. even so, modern engineering makes sure this isn't the situation. by way of innovative structural Examination and the use of large-top quality, large-toughness materials, lightweight enlargement tanks are intended to be exceptionally robust and sturdy. The weight reduction comes from eliminating redundant product, not from compromising structural integrity.

in truth, optimized style and design can in some cases bring on improved longevity by better distributing pressure and reducing opportunity failure factors. The end result is surely an enlargement tank by using a long and responsible company lifetime. This extended operational lifespan is really a cornerstone of sustainability.

an extended provider existence right interprets to some lower substitution frequency. If a tank lasts for a longer period, much less tanks should be produced in excess of the lifetime of a making program. This decreases the cumulative need for raw elements, producing Power, and transportation linked to making substitution models. What's more, it noticeably cuts down on the level of waste created when outdated tanks are decommissioned and discarded. significantly less Repeated alternative suggests less content heading to landfills or recycling facilities, easing the burden on waste administration devices.

Supporting eco-friendly System Integration: Amplifying Over-all performance

enlargement tanks do not work in isolation; they are integral elements of more substantial heating, cooling, and potable h2o techniques. The move to light-weight and effective expansion tanks performs a crucial job in supporting the general sustainability ambitions of such built-in methods.

modern day HVAC and plumbing methods progressively integrate higher-performance systems for instance variable-velocity pumps, condensing boilers, solar thermal collectors, and ground-resource warmth pumps. To maximise the many benefits of these State-of-the-art technologies, every single component throughout the program must carry out optimally and synergistically. A very well-built, appropriately sized light-weight expansion tank ensures the hydraulic stability and efficiency of your system without having introducing needless bulk or inefficiency.

On top of that, in certain applications, the general bodyweight of your method factors might be a layout consideration. This could possibly be appropriate in modular or prefabricated design, rooftop installations, or retrofits in older structures with structural limitations. employing light-weight factors like optimized growth tanks contributes to lessening the overall system mass, most likely simplifying set up and structural needs.

Critically, the selection of verifiably sustainable elements has started to become more and more critical for inexperienced setting up certifications like LEED (Management in Power and Environmental design and style) or BREEAM (setting up Research Establishment Environmental evaluation Method). Specifying lightweight enlargement tanks produced with optimized supplies and processes can contribute precious points to obtaining these certifications, maximizing the building's environmental credentials and current market value.
